Demo Now Available for Eldritch Cult Simulator ‘Worship’ [Trailer]
If you remember Chasing Rats Games’ Kickstarter for their Lovecraftian cult simulator Worship back in 2021, you’ll be pleased to know that the project is still very much alive. In fact, Chasing Rats Games has a new hands-on demo available now on Steam (as well as a new trailer) as part of the Save & Sound Festival, with Worship aiming for an “early 2025” release on Steam.
Teeming with an hour of eldritch horrors and sacrificial rites, the demo for Worship casts you as a cult leader, who must gather their devout while converting new souls to their cause to feed the insatiable hunger of the unseen gods. As you grow your following, you will find your jolly followers serve many purposes, all splendidly sinister.
While the demo supports is single-player only, Worship will launch early next year with four-player co-op, inviting you and your chosen cultists to reign together.
Players will purge heretics who stand in their way, using the heretics’ blood to restore their strength, and aid in unravelling puzzles. Finally, kneel at the altar and pray for a Test of Faith. Complete it, and you will bring the world one trembling step closer to the end of days as you gain more power.

‘System Shock 2: 25th Anniversary’ Now Available on the Nintendo Switch 2; Free Upgrade Available
Nightdive Studios has given Nintendo Switch 2 fans some love when it comes to System Shock 2: 25th Anniversary. Previously released for the original Switch, players can now grab the Switch 2 version from the Nintendo eShop. Or, if you already own the Switch version, you can grab the Switch 2 version as a free upgrade! There’s even a 40% discount on now until June 23.
Initially launching for PC via Steam, Epic Games Store, GOG, and Humble Store on last June, System Shock 2: 25th Anniversary Remaster eventually made it to the PlayStation 5, Xbox Series,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and Switch the next month. The Switch 2 version of the game offers enhanced resolution, higher fram rate, and support for mouse control.
Set 42 years after the events of the first game, it’s the year 2114. As you awake from cryo sleep on the FTL ship Von Braun, you are unable to remember who or where you are… and something has gone terribly wrong. Hybrid mutants and deadly robots roam the halls while the cries from the remaining crew reverberate through the cold hull of the ship. SHODAN, a rogue AI bent on the destruction of mankind has taken over and it’s up to you to stop her.
